5:41Now PlayingThis is a complaint email received by a comedy club after I'd performed a work-in-progress show there. Luckily the comedy club film everything so could review the footage and see that the claims are totally false (I didn't even talk about most of the topics they claim). And if they saw my show previously and found me "horrific", why did they come to see me again? But it shows why so many diverse heterodox voices are being pushed off the live circuit.

Cancel culture is making an already precarious occupation untenable for a comedian like me. Any accusation of racism, transphobia, misogyny is like accusing someone of witchcraft in Salem in 1693 - everyone is terrified of being tarred with association, promoters are scared to let you near the cows in case your sorcery sours the milk in their udders. I won't embarrass them by naming but some clubs I used to work for have stopped booking me.
I'm not sure if they were even at the show. They got basic details wrong. Other people enjoyed it. It's new material, sometimes it's going to stray over the line. Other comedians have suffered hecklers, complaints, online campaigns. Cancel culture is real, it's pernicious and it's narrowing the diversity of voices you're allowed to hear.
I'm putting my energy into YouTube, podcasting with 3 Speech and Lotus Eaters, and TV/radio. I'm building my own following so I can tour my own show to my own audience. I'll always be loyal to the clubs who book me (who seem to be the ones that are growing - funny that) and ones that don't can suck my balls.
